North Tampa Bay Chamber VIP Ribbon Cutting at AdventHealth Care Pavilion Central Pasco strives for convenient health care that’s streamlined at every step

Leaders from the Pasco County community joined the AdventHealth team to celebrate the ribbon cutting for their new AdventHealth Care Pavilion in Central Pasco. Ardith Tennant, AdventHealth Care Pavilion West Florida Marketing Director welcomed those in attendance. “We are proud to serve Pasco County with expert care under one roof and look forward to caring for you and your loved ones!”

The Invocation was given by Joseph Rivera, AdventHealth West Florida, Vice President of Mission and Ministry with the Care Pavilion and an overview given by Jason Newmyer, AdventHealth West Florida President of Ambulatory Services.

Erik Wangsness Advent Health Wesley Chapel president and CEO spoke of the challenges and opportunities regarding bringing the highest quality Healthcare in Pasco County.

North Tampa Bay Chamber held their VIP Ribbon Cutting followed by the designers and builders of the AdventHealth Care Pavilion Central Pasco.

Whole-Person Care Close to Home is all about believing in convenient health care that’s streamlined at every step, and that’s what AdventHealth Care Pavilion Central Pasco strives for. Before you arrive, you can make appointments, complete your registration, and talk to your care team — all online.

At their Care Pavilion, you’ll be able to skip the waiting room, be seen on your schedule with evening hours and can check several visits off your to-do list with multiple services in one building, including:

Primary care and pediatrics, Specialty medicine, Diagnostic imaging (MRI, CT, X-ray, ultrasound, bone density and mammography) and Outpatient lab services.

A major plus is their full-service AdventHealth emergency room next door to their Care Pavilion, ensuring ER care is nearby when you need it.
